Lipotropic substances are agents that help facilitate the breakdown of fat and support its removal from the liver. They are most commonly known through specialized injections or oral supplements marketed for weight management, and their effectiveness largely depends on the specific blend of nutrients used. The Core Lipotropic Complex (MIC)

Many lipotropic formulas, especially injections, are built around a central trio of compounds known as MIC: Methionine, Inositol, and Choline. These three work synergistically to support the liver's processing of fat.

Methionine

As an essential amino acid, methionine is crucial for various metabolic functions. Its primary role in lipotropic formulas is to act as a methyl donor, assisting the liver in breaking down fats. By doing so, it helps prevent the excessive accumulation of fat within the liver. Methionine also aids in the synthesis of other vital amino acids and proteins within the body.

Inositol

This vitamin-like substance, sometimes referred to as Vitamin B8, plays a significant role in cell structure and signal transduction. In the context of lipotropics, inositol supports nerve function and helps the body's insulin and glucose metabolism. It also plays a role in transporting fat away from the liver, which aids in its removal and distribution for energy use.

Choline

An essential nutrient, choline is a precursor to the neurotransmitter acetylcholine and is vital for fat transport and metabolism. It helps prevent fats from getting trapped in the liver and supports its function, which is critical for processing and excreting waste products. Choline works in concert with inositol to regulate fat and bile flow from the liver.

Additional Common Lipotropic Ingredients

Beyond the MIC blend, many formulas include other vitamins and nutrients to boost energy and metabolism, enhance fat utilization, and support overall health.

  • Vitamin B12: This is one of the most common additions to lipotropic injections due to its crucial role in energy production. A deficiency in B12 can lead to fatigue, so supplementing it can boost energy levels, helping to counteract the sluggishness that can accompany dieting.
  • Vitamin B Complex (B1, B2, B6): Other B vitamins are often included to further enhance metabolism. Vitamin B1 (thiamine) helps convert carbohydrates into energy, while Vitamin B6 (pyridoxine) is involved in breaking down proteins, fats, and carbohydrates.
  • L-Carnitine: This amino acid plays a key role in transporting long-chain fatty acids into the mitochondria of cells, where they are oxidized (burned) for energy. L-carnitine essentially acts as a shuttle for fat-burning, which can help support weight loss goals.
  • Betaine: As another methyl donor, betaine is found in some formulas to support liver function alongside methionine.
  • Folate (Vitamin B9): This vitamin is a cofactor for the conversions involved in hepatic transmethylation reactions, further supporting liver processes.

The Role of Lipotropics in Weight Management

It is important to understand that while these ingredients support metabolic functions, they are not a magic solution for weight loss. For best results, they are intended to complement a comprehensive program that includes a balanced diet and regular exercise. For instance, the B vitamins boost energy, which can help motivate increased physical activity. The liver-supporting ingredients help optimize a crucial organ for fat metabolism, but significant fat loss still depends on burning more calories than you consume.

Comparison: Injections vs. Oral Supplements

Lipotropic nutrients can be administered via injection or taken as an oral supplement. There are key differences to consider.

Feature Lipotropic Injections Oral Supplements
Absorption Rapidly absorbed directly into the bloodstream. Must be absorbed through the digestive system; absorption rate can vary.
Ingredient Potency Often contain higher, clinical doses administered under medical supervision. Varies widely; not regulated by the FDA in the same way as injections.
Route of Administration Administered by a healthcare professional or self-administered under guidance. Taken orally as capsules, tablets, or liquid drops.
Effectiveness May be more effective for individuals with poor oral absorption. May be sufficient for general metabolic support, but potentially less potent.
Convenience Requires regular clinic visits or preparation for self-administration. Easily integrated into a daily vitamin routine.
